Top Gear’s spokespeople will not comment on the identity of its beloved racing driver, and rumours are there is actually more than one Stig.
Few people really know if The Stig is Ben Collins. But if the rumours are true, just who is the man behind the helmet?
Ben Collins began racing in Formula First and Formula Vauxhall Junior at 19, before competing in Formula 3 racing – two tiers behind World Champion Lewis Hamilton in Formula 1.
Collins was reported as setting the pace for the Le Mans series in 2001, and competed in the 2005 British GT Championship in a Porsche 911 GT3…a car which Top Gear fanatic and Jamiroquai frontman Jay Kay (see below) is particularly keen on.
Ben Collins then moved up to the FIA GT series, and was a test driver for carmaker Ascari, during development of its hardcore A10 supercar.

He’s also appeared on Top Gear – fuelling speculation from an early stage of his helmeted-alter ego – when a skydiving parachutist jumped from an aeroplane into the backseat of a convertible Mercedes-Benz driven at high speed by Collins.
He also raced a ‘mountain-boarding’ world champion in a Bowler Wildcat, and was part of a five-a-side football team driving Toyota Aygos, captained by Richard Hammond – who was recently reported as injuring himself after falling off a horse.
And speaking of Hammond injuring himself, a report into his 2006 high-speed accident revealed Collins had apparently “worked closely with Top Gear as a high performance driver and consultant”.

But the ‘world’s luckiest man’ scored another dream role, after his driving skills were required to fill in for the world’s greatest secret agent…and one of Britain’s best exports.
Yes, Ben Collins was a stunt driver in 2008’s James Bond film Quantum of Solace, and drove the super-sexy Aston Martin DBS.
The Daily Telegraph quoted Collins as saying: “It was a bit like a dream come true to work on a Bond film. On the first day filming I had to pinch myself as I was sitting there in Bond’s pinstripe suit with an Omega watch.
“There were sheer drops of a thousand feet on some of the roads. I think a highlight was sliding the DBS up the mountain road between two giant rocks…”

But if it really is Ben Collins, then he may want to start looking for a new job. When the old Stig – Perry McCarthy – revealed his black-suited alter-ego in an autobiography, he was promptly shown the wrong end of an aircraft carrier, and into the sea.
